Excellent Services in Addison, IL is best suited for seniors who require hands-on medical oversight, especially wound care and post-operative nursing, delivered by a capable clinical team when the family can provide robust care coordination. The standout strength is medical responsiveness: skilled nursing and wound-management capabilities that can translate into meaningful recovery gains. For families seeking practical, outcome-focused care rather than a heavy emphasis on social programming, this community can be a reliable medical anchor. In other words, when the primary need is clinical intervention and steady monitoring, this facility often delivers where it matters most.
This option is not ideal for everyone. Those who prioritize flawless, predictable communication and universal English-speaking staff should look elsewhere. The reviews reveal ongoing communication frictions and language barriers that complicate day-to-day care coordination. If a single, consistent point of contact and smooth, bilingual (or English-only) communication are non-negotiable, alternatives with stronger, more transparent care-management structures are worth evaluating. Families that expect effortless collaboration across disciplines and a consistently proactive front desk may find the experience lacking here.
On the upside, the clinical strengths can meaningfully offset several of the operational drawbacks. When wound care or nursing needs are front-and-center, staff competence is repeatedly highlighted, with hands-on post-op care delivered with professionalism and technical skill. Those who require rapid escalation of medical needs, regular dressing changes, or vigilant monitoring through therapy and medications may experience tangible benefits. The owner's routine follow-ups suggest responsive leadership that can steer care back on track, which is a meaningful compensatory factor when occasional missteps occur.
Yet the downsides are serious enough to reshape the risk-reward calculus. Communication gaps - delayed responses, missed messages, and promises that go unfulfilled - have a real impact on trust and continuity of care. A specific critique points to a caregiver who did not maintain professionalism and did not respond to repeated contact attempts, creating anxiety around post-discharge planning and care transitions. The pattern of long gaps between conversations, combined with perceived misrepresentations about what could be delivered, undermines confidence in day-to-day reliability. Compounding this is a language barrier among some caregivers, which necessitates family members or the owner stepping in to bridge conversations, a process that distracts from direct patient care.
To navigate this landscape, demand a clearly assigned point person for all care plans, with written protocols that specify response times and follow-up expectations.Insist on a dedicated wound-care coordinator and ensure shifts include English-speaking staff or a translator arrangement to minimize ambiguity. Clarify how visits from physicians or external practitioners will be integrated into the shared care plan, and push for transparent, documented progress notes that all parties can review. With disciplined oversight and explicit communication pathways, the strong clinical core can be leveraged while keeping care coordination predictable and credible.
The bottom line is clear: Excellent Services offers a solid medical care engine for seniors who require skilled recovery support and meticulous wound management, provided families are prepared to manage and monitor communication actively. For households where consistent, language-concordant communication and unwavering responsiveness are essential, this facility may require benchmarks or even alternative options. The clinical capability is real and compelling, but without disciplined, proactive care coordination, the day-to-day experience can devolve into a management challenge. Careful upfront questions, concrete expectations, and a commitment to structured communication will determine whether this community becomes the right fit.

Located in Addison, Illinois, this area provides a variety of amenities that cater to the needs of seniors. With several pharmacies located within a short distance, accessing necessary medications is convenient. Nearby parks offer opportunities for outdoor recreation and relaxation, while a selection of restaurants provide dining options for different preferences. Transportation options include Metra train stations and airport access for travel needs. For entertainment, there are theaters nearby for movie lovers. Additionally, cafes like Starbucks are perfect for socializing or enjoying a quiet cup of coffee. Access to medical facilities such as DuPage Medical Group and hospitals like Edward-Elmhurst Health Center ensures quality healthcare services within reach. Places of worship like College Church and St Andrews Episcopal Church offer spiritual support as well. This area in Addison provides a comfortable and convenient environment for senior living with ample resources and facilities to meet various needs.
